Stop 1: Mount Batur and Black Lava Fields

Your adventure kicks off with a visit to the black lava fields, which are a testament to Mount Batur’s volcanic activity. Created by eruptions over the years, these hardened lava flows are both dramatic and photogenic. As one review notes, the terrain is raw and captivating, providing a stark contrast to Bali’s lush greenery elsewhere.

Travelers can expect to ride across hardened volcanic rock, which offers a different kind of landscape — almost lunar in appearance. The driver and guide (often praised for their knowledge and friendliness) will share insights into the volcano’s history and the formation of the lava fields, adding educational value to the trip.

Stop 2: Mount Batur Jeep Sunrise & Volcano Exploration

The highlight for many is the sunrise from the top of Mount Batur, standing at 1,717 meters. As dawn breaks, the caldera and Lake Batur are bathed in golden light, a sight described as breathtaking. Guests often comment on the panoramic views and the feeling of witnessing something truly special.

The ride in the private 4×4 jeep up the mountain is described as both exhilarating and comfortable, with reviewers noting the friendly and punctual driver. The terrain can be bumpy, but the vehicle’s 4WD capabilities ensure a smooth ride.
